American Airlines Bets on Philadelphia and the A321XLR for Summer 2027

Executive Brief
The 30-second read
American Airlines will launch a seven-route European expansion in summer 2027 utilizing the Airbus A321XLR. The strategy positions Philadelphia as a primary transatlantic gateway to optimize narrow-body efficiency in secondary international markets.
- 01Deployment of A321XLR aircraft targets thinner European routes previously inaccessible to wide-body jets
- 02Philadelphia hub undergoes strategic strengthening to serve as the main transatlantic departure point
- 03Expansion aims to mitigate the billion-dollar profit disparity between American and its primary domestic competitors
- 04New narrow-body long-haul capabilities offer increased frequency and reach into underserved regional European hubs
